Roy is a 2 year old pointer cross boy who was brought into the shelter as a stray in July 2024. He is always looking out from his kennel waiting for human attention, relishing it when he is lucky enough to get some – he has the softest coat.

He has happily shared his kennel with many other dogs – seeing many come and go. When you meet him, he looks you right in the eyes as if to say please take me home. Or please help me find a home.

It’s not clear whether Roy was in a home before, but his affinity for people suggests that maybe he did. Or maybe he was a hunting dog that was no longer needed – which is also a possibility as he was very thin when he arrived at the shelter.

He has now put on some weight and is more than ready for his forever home.

Unfortunately for Roy, he is leishmania positive, meaning he continually overlooked. Please don’t let this disease define him.

It is easily managed with cheap tablets, doesn’t affect how long he will live, doesn’t affect insurance premiums, and cannot be transmitted to other pets or humans.

Many dogs live long and happy lives with leishmania. Roy is otherwise a healthy boy.

We just hope someone sees how wonderful he is regardless of leishmania because he will be the most awesome pet, loyal, loving and the best friend and companion anyone could wish for.

Roy can fly to the UK as soon as a home is offered.
